All eyes on Nkabini primary schoolNOMPENDULO NGUBANE>>nompendulo.ngubane@myecho.co.za
COMING from a history of arondavel, Nkabini PrimarySchool is now drawing
attention in the Mafunze area inElandskopthankstoapersonalisedschool gate.
The smell from the garden tellsa story that both the vegetable andflower gardens are nursedproperly.
Principal of the schoolBhekani Ndlovu took the Echoback to 1961, when the schoolwas simply the rondavel ofAbsalom Nkabini, the founder ofthe school.
He also added that while theschool was operating, theNgcobo clan had an argumentwith the Nkabini family as theyclaimed that a piece of landwhere the school is built belongedto the Ngcobo family (both families
in Mafunze).In 1970, when the school
needed more space toaccommodate children, a newbuilding was erected which iswhere the school stands today.
“The school was built ofplanks and it was like that up until1994, when renovations started.We have added three more blockswhich has allowed the school togrow to 925pupils fromGradeR toGradeseventhisyear.Wenowhavea library and computer laboratorythat offers computer studies tomembers of the community,” hesaid.
Not onlyhas the school changedits look, but the academic resultsare satisfactory, he added.
“We have had our pupilsentering competitions such as themaths olympiad and they excel insport. The teachers are also doinga great job in making sure that thepupilsare taughtaccordingly,” saidNdlovu.
PHOTO:NOMPENDULO NGUBANEZothani Mkhize is a clerk at Nkabini Primary School.
Things to know aboutNkabini primary school
•It has 27 teachers•They offer cricket as asport in the school•Their athletic teamwent to the SportsAthletics competitionrecently at a districtlevel.•The school helps outand provides schooluniforms to needypupils.•They work withdifferent stakeholdersto better the school.

WHILE employment has increasedfrom2.1million in2010to2.4millionin 2014 in KwaZulu-Natal, poverty,
crime and social inequality remain at the coreof the province’s problems.
Speaking at the State of the ProvinceAddress (SOPA) at the Royal Showgrounds onFriday, Premier Senzo Mchunu said povertyand inequality remain persistent, with thepercentage of people in the province livingbelow the food poverty line of R318 permonthhaving risen from25% in2010 to28% in2014.
He raised concerns about the escalatingcrime rate in the province which impactsnegatively on economic growth. Mchunu saidthatasa result, a total of130police stationsarecurrently being evaluated to identifychallenges and shortfalls so as to assist inimproving policing in the province.
Hesaid thatgovernment isconcernedaboutthe escalation of farm murders and tensionbetween commercial farmers and farmtenants or labourers.
“Theprovincehasseenan increaseover thelast year in crimes related to murder, stocktheft,attemptedmurder,assaultandarson.Wetherefore call for intensified action frompolicingandcriminal justice structures to stemthe tide of such crime,” he said.
Mchunu called on the private sector to joinforces with the government in order to be ableto grow the economy.
Meanwhile leader of the DA in the KZNLegislature, Sizwe Mchunu, has cited theemployment figures as being misleading, asaccording to their calculations unemployment
has increased by 5.7% over the 2013/2014period.
“In line with provincial government’s 2030vision, economic growth rate was lower thanexpected, social inequality figures remainedstagnant at 17% and consistently high crimelevels continue to destabilise and limitinvestment in the province.
“Out of the unemployment statistics, thepremier did not make a reference that theyrelate to 70% of the youth in our province.”
IFPMPLBlessedGwalasaid thePremierdidnottouchonimportantissues,sayingthatwhilea major portion of the budget will be given tothe education sector, itwill not be used to servethe needs of the people.

BMW droptop 2Series available here
>> Sleek new wheels for car fanatics
FOLLOWING the launch of its new 2Series Active Tourer in South Africa inFebruary, BMW will expand its local
2 series lineup with the addition of a newrearwheel drive convertible in March.
The new 2 Series convertible, replacingthe 1 Series droptop, borrows heavily from
its coupé sibling (launched in SA in March2014) in terms of specification and design,though tweaks were made toaccommodate its fabric roof.
Compared to its predecessor, its lengthhas increased by 72mm to 4.4m, width by26mm to 1.7m, wheelbase by 30mm to
2.6m and it also has a 35mm widerrearhatch.
The new 2 Series convertible will beavailable in South Africa in three petrol
180kW/350Nm) and 220i 135kW/270Nm.Engines can be mated to either a sixspeedmanual or eightspeed auto.
The new convertible is offered in fourspecifications Advantage, Luxury Line,Sport Line and M Sport.
Prices will be released closer to itsofficial launch date on March 15.
Its powered fabric roof (black, silveror brown) can open or close in20 seconds at up to 50km/h so youdon’t have to stop traffic if rain suddenlylooms.
Luggage capacity has increased by 20litres to 280 with the top open and by 30litres to 335 with the top closed.
It borrows standard equipment fromthe coupé version, including BMWProfessional radio (with iDrive operatingsystem), control display with a flatscreendesign and auto aircon with convertiblemode.
Optional extras include leather trimwith SunReflective technology (reducessurface heating in direct sunshine) andsatnav with touch controller.
Driver assistance aids include BMWConnectedDrive which comprisesanti dazzle highbeam assistant,adaptive headlights, parking assistwith reversing camera, speed limitInfo (with ‘No Passing’ info display) andcruise control with auto braking.

THEnewRangeRoverEvoque, sporting anewdesign and a host of the automaker’s latesttechnologies, will make its debut at the 2015Geneva auto show.
Land Rover SA says it could be in SouthAfrica by August 2015.
Land Rover design director and chiefcreative officer Gerry McGovern said: “TheRangeRoverEvoque first establishedand thendominated the luxury compact SUV sectorgenerating worldwide acclaim and salessuccess. Our challenge has been to evolve theEvoque design without diluting its distinctivecharacter.”
The new Evoque’s trim levels have beenrealigned to match those of the Range RoverSport—SE,HSEDynamicandAutobiography,and a suite of option packs.
ThenewEvoquegains enlargedair intakes,newgrille designs and iswill be the first RangeRover to be offered with adaptive LEDheadlights. The Evoque’s standard grille isdistinguished by two bold horizontal bars anda new fine-mesh pattern.
In South Africa, the new SUV will bepowered with a 2.2-litre SD4 turbo dieselengine (paired with a nine-speed auto) andLand Rover’s 2.0-litre Si4 turbo petrol.
With 177kW on tap, the Si4 petrol engine
deliversstrongperformance,withaccelerationfrom 0-100km/h in just 7.6 seconds and a topspeedof217km/h.Fueleconomyisratedat7.8litres/100km and 181g/km emissions.
Interiorchangesincludenewseatsanddoorcasings, 20cm touch-screen infotainment unitand the introduction of new colours andmaterials. Its hands-freepower tailgate allowsowners to automatically open and closethe boot by waving a foot beneath the rearbumper.
It’s equipped with Land Rover’s innovativeAll- Terrain Progress Control (ATPC), onlyavailable on Si4 derivatives, first seen onthe Range Rover and Range Rover Sport. Thetechnologymaintains a pre-determined speed(selected using the cruise control function) inforward or reverse gears between 1.8km/h to30km/h, allowing the driver to concentrate onnegotiating tricky terrain.
Its autonomous emergency brakingprevents or greatly reduces the severity ofcrashes in the event of the driver failing to takepreventative action. Using an advancedforward-facing stereo digital camera, thesystem can identify potential hazards ahead.
Prices will be will be announced closer tolaunch.

Endless fireworksexpected in theSoweto derbyTHE much-talked about
andpopularSowetoderbybetween the two South
African giants, Orlando Piratesand Kaizer Chiefs, is going to bea humdinger.
The two most followedSoweto teamswill lock horns onSaturday, 3pm at FNB Stadiumand two former players of bothsides have made theirpredictions of the outcome.
Pietermaritzburg-born andformer Amakhosi goalkeeperArthur Bartman says the matchis always exciting and no teamwants to lose because of thebragging rights and pride atstake.
Bartmansayscoachesofbothteams,EricTinklerofPiratesandStuart Baxter (Chiefs), won’thave any difficulties inmotivating players.
“Just to play for those teamsis a privilege and to play in thehistorical Soweto derby it’s anhonour on its own.
Players get motivated for thewhole week prior to the match.
“If you attend the training
sessions for both teams you canactually see it in the players bodylanguage.
“The atmosphere stay tense forthe whole week,” says Bartman.
Bartman predicts Amakhosiare likely to walk away aswinners because they started on
the positive note in the season andare still leading the pack.
“Let’s admit it, Chiefs startedon a high note. They are stilllog leaders and expected to takethe game as leaders or aspotential league champions.
“I personally think Chiefs willwin it,” said Bartman.
Former Pirates defender andLamontville Golden Arrowsassistant coach Bheka Phakathi
strongly believes Bucs willeventually win it because they canscore goals.
“If you look at all Chiefsgames, they are only good ormaybe perfect in set-pieces likecorners and free kicks.
“On the other side Piratesmidfielders are all creators andtheir strikers are scoring goalseveryday.
“SoChiefs are likely todependontheir tall defenders or keepon praying hard that they receivea lot of free kicks or corners.
“There is no ways, Pirateswill take it on Saturday,” saidPhakathi.
Pirates coach Tinkler says hisonly worry is at the back, but it willbe sorted.
“Wearecurrentlyworkingonourdefence.”
Baxter says the best plan to winagainst their traditional arch-rivalswill be to step up the gear from thefirst whistle.
“Weneed toputpressureon theirdefence andwork hard from the on-set.”
